What Is Included
Building a custom home with S.Hines is a turn-key experience. From raw site clearing and Borough permit management to energy envelope sealing and final timber trim, Shane oversees every phase on site.
- ✓ Full design-build coordination with architects and structural engineers
- ✓ Borough permitting, site clearing, soil evaluation, well & septic coordination
- ✓ Insulated concrete form (ICF) or engineered continuous-insulation foundation systems
- ✓ Advanced 2x8 wall assemblies, R-38+ wall insulation, R-60 attic insulation
- ✓ Triple-pane Low-E window packages with custom thermal jambs
- ✓ Hydronic radiant floor heating, dual-fuel boilers, and HRV air quality systems
- ✓ Custom finish carpentry, timber framing accents, tilework, and solid cabinetry
- ✓ Comprehensive pre-handover blower door testing and final walkthrough
Sub-Zero Cold-Climate Enhancements
- • Blower-door sealed 6-mil air/vapor barrier envelope
- • Frost-Protected Shallow Foundations (FPSF)
- • High snow-load structural roof framing with ice-dam barrier membranes
- • Continuous heat recovery ventilation (HRV) for condensation prevention
